Understanding Your Power Recliner's Needs
Before diving into battery pack options, understanding your recliner's power requirements is crucial. Check your owner's manual for specifics, including:
- Voltage: This is typically 12V DC for most reclining furniture. Incorrect voltage can damage your furniture and the battery pack.
- Amperage (Amps): This indicates the current draw. Higher amperage usually means faster motor operation and potentially more features.
- Power Consumption: This will help you determine the appropriate battery capacity. Look for information on wattage (W) or amp-hours (Ah).
Identifying Your Recliner Type
Different recliners have different power needs:
- Single Motor Recliners: These typically use less power than dual motor models.
- Dual Motor Recliners: Offering independent back and footrest adjustment, these require more power.
- Lift Recliners: Designed to assist with standing, these demand the most power.
Choosing the Right Battery Pack for Your Recliner
The market offers various battery pack options for reclining furniture. Consider these factors when making your choice:
- Battery Capacity (Ah): Higher Ah ratings generally equate to longer operating times before needing a recharge. Consider your usage patterns; do you frequently use the reclining function?
- Voltage (V): Ensure the battery pack's voltage matches your recliner's requirements. Mismatched voltage is a critical issue and can cause damage.
- Connector Type: Make sure the battery pack connector is compatible with your recliner's power input. Many use standard DC connectors, but variations exist.
- Recharge Time: How quickly the battery pack recharges will influence your usage convenience.
- Safety Features: Look for features like overcharge protection, short-circuit protection, and temperature control to ensure safety.
- Warranty: A good warranty provides peace of mind and indicates the manufacturer's confidence in their product.
Types of Battery Packs
- Lead-Acid Batteries: These are a common, cost-effective option, but they are heavier and have a shorter lifespan compared to other technologies.
- Lithium-ion Batteries: Offering higher energy density, longer lifespan, and lighter weight, these are a more premium, but often more worthwhile, choice.
Installing and Maintaining Your Battery Pack
The installation process varies depending on the battery pack and your recliner model. Consult your battery pack's instructions and potentially your recliner's manual for detailed guidance. Improper installation can lead to malfunction or damage. Generally, it involves connecting the battery pack to your recliner's power input.
Regular maintenance will prolong your battery pack's lifespan. This might include:
- Regular Charging: Avoid letting the battery completely discharge.
- Proper Storage: Store the battery pack in a cool, dry place when not in use.
- Cleaning: Keep the battery pack terminals clean and free from debris.
Troubleshooting Common Issues
- Battery Not Charging: Check the power cord, wall outlet, and battery pack connections.
- Recliner Not Working: Verify the battery pack is properly connected and charged. Check the fuses within the battery pack and recliner.
- Short Battery Life: Consider replacing the battery pack if it doesn't hold a charge for a reasonable duration.
